Paris young girl raised in the confines of a small town, surrounded by the simplicity of family, nature, and the bonds of love. Struggling through a childhood scarred by trauma, she faces overwhelming obstacles that shape her into someone who hides her pain behind a brave face. As she moves into adolescence & adulthood the weight of her past continues to haunt her, making it harder to trust, love, and heal.

Paris was determined to protect her daughter, Zion at all cost. Paris grew up believing that surviving is enough. But as the years unfold, the unresolved wounds begin to manifest in mental health struggles that threaten to unravel everything she's fought for.

In a desperate search for healing, Paris embarks on a life-altering journey of self-discovery, learning to confront her pain and embrace her purpose. With courage she never knew she had, she steps into the light, determined to give others like her the hope she once thought she lost. This is a story of triumph over trauma, reminding us all that our past doesn't define us, but the way we rise from it does. Paris explores the importance of patience, perseverance, and the unyielding power of hope, love, lessons, and moments of growth that make the journey worthwhile.

No, Not Again is a raw, inspiring story of survival, resilience, and the transformative power of walking in your true purpose.
